International School Of Technology And Sciences For Women Fee, Structure
The fee structure for International School Of Technology And Sciences For Women courses vary from each other. The fee structure also varies depending upon the level and specialisation of the programme one choose. Candidates who pass all rounds of International School Of Technology And Sciences For Women admission process must pay a part of the course fee to confirm admission to their desired programmes. The course fee may include various fee components, including Tuition Fees, Hostel Fees, One-time fee and more. For the course-wise International School Of Technology And Sciences For Women fee details, refer to the section below:

Courses | Eligibility |
---|---|
B.E. / B.Tech | Candidates who have passed Diploma in Engineering or any other examination recognised as equivalent there to, from a recognised Institute/ University, Andhra Pradesh/ Telangana are also eligible. Candidates who have appeared in Diploma in Engineering and who are awaiting their results can also apply on provisional basis. Candidates should belong to the state of Andhra Pradesh/ Telangana. Candidate should have completed 16 years of age as of 31st December of the year of admission (2023). There is no upper age limit. |
MBA/PGDM | Candidate must have completed Bachelor degree of 3/4 years duration with above mentioned marks from any recognised University/Institute. 45% marks for BC categories. Candidate who are appearing for the final year degree examination are also be eligible. Degree obtained by Distance Mode Program should have recognition by Joint Committee of UGC, AICTE and DEC/DEB. Candidate who passed all the subjects of the three years of any Degree course in one sitting is not eligible for admission. |
After 10th Diploma | Candidates should have passed S.S.C. Examination (Class 10th) conducted by State Board of Secondary Education, Andhra Pradesh/ Telangana or any other examination recognised as equivalent thereto by the Board of Secondary Education, A.P/TS. such as CBSE, ICSE, NIOS, A.P. Open School Society (APOSS), X class examination conducted by various State Boards of Secondary Education in India with Mathematics as one of the subjects. Candidates belonging to NIOS/APOSS/Other Examinations recognised as equivalent to SSC by A.P. Govt. should have passed all the subjects including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ry, with minimum of 35% marks in each subject. Candidates who appeared or are appearing for SSC or equivalent examination being held in April/ May-2023, and whose results are yet to be declared can also apply. There is no age restriction. |
M.E./M.Tech | Candidate must have passsed B.E./B.Tech. in relevant stream and obtained at least 50% marks (45% in case of reserved category candidates) from an AICTE/UGC approved institution recognised by the Government of Andhra Pradesh as equivalent thereto. Final year appearing students may also apply on provisional basis. |
